NTT DoCoMo (DoCoMo) and High Tech Computer Corp. (HTC) announced recently that they have developed a handset, "hTc Z," equipped with the Microsoft Windows Mobile 5.0 Japanese-edition operating system. DoCoMo will start sales in late July.
The hTc Z will enable a variety of useful mobile business solutions using Windows Server and Exchange Server, in addition to Bluetooth and a number of add-in applications. DoCoMo plans to sell the handsets to corporate customers as part of its comprehensive business solutions. The dual-mode W-CDMA and GSM/GPRS handset will offer voice, video and packet communications compatible with Wireless LAN and will feature a QWERTY keyboard.
